Construct a frequency distribution table for the following marks obtained by 25 students in a history test in class VI of a school:
$$9,17,12,20,9,18,25,17,19,9,12,9,12,18,17,19,20,25,9,12,17,19,19,20,9$$
The number of students who obtained $$20\ marks =$$ ____.

Given that
the marks obtained by $$25$$ students in a history test in class VI of a school
$$9, 17, 12, 20, 9, 18, 25, 17, 19, 9, 12, 9, 12, 18, 17, 19, 20, 25, 9, 12, 17, 19, 19, 20, 9$$
Frequency Distribution table:

Marks No. of students obtained that marks
$$9$$ $$6$$
$$12$$ $$4$$
$$17$$ $$4$$
$$18$$ $$2$$
$$19$$ $$4$$
$$20$$ $$3$$
$$25$$ $$2$$
Thus, the number of students who obtained $$20\ marks = 3$$
